SyscomX HDMI 200M KVM IP Extender

Product Overview

The SyscomX HDMI 200M KVM IP Extender is designed to extend HDMI video signals and keyboard/mouse control over an Ethernet network for distances of up to 200 meters.

The system consists of:

  • TX Unit – Transmitter
  • RX Unit – Receiver

It allows video transmission and remote computer control between the source device and the display. The product supports direct point-to-point connection as well as network-based distribution.

Connection Modes

Point-to-Point

Connects one transmitter to one receiver for extending video and control signals to a remote location.

Point-to-Multipoint

Connects one transmitter to multiple receivers through an Ethernet switch, allowing the same source to be displayed at multiple locations.

Cascade Connection

Supports cascaded network connections for expanding the distribution system according to the network topology.


TX Unit Ports

TX – Transmitter

  • Ethernet: RJ45 network port for connection to the receiver or Ethernet switch.
  • USB: USB port for connecting the source computer and enabling KVM control.
  • IR TX: Infrared transmitter connection.
  • HDMI IN: HDMI input from a computer, recorder, media player, or other video source.
  • HDMI OUT: Local HDMI output for connecting a nearby display.
  • DC/5V: 5 V DC power input.

RX Unit Ports

RX – Receiver

  • Ethernet: RJ45 network port for receiving data from the transmitter or Ethernet switch.
  • USB1: USB port for a keyboard or mouse.
  • USB2: Additional USB port for a keyboard or mouse.
  • IR-RX: Infrared receiver connection.
  • HDMI OUT: HDMI output for connecting a monitor, television, or projector.
  • DC/5V: 5 V DC power input.

Resolutions Shown on the Packaging

The product packaging shows support references for:

  • 1080p Full HD
  • 2K Quad HD
  • 4K Ultra HD

However, the packaging images do not provide a detailed table confirming the maximum supported refresh rate or the transmission distance available for each resolution. These specifications should therefore be verified through testing or the manufacturer’s manual before deployment.

Basic Installation

  1. Connect the video source to the HDMI IN port on the TX unit.
  2. Connect the TX USB port to the source computer for KVM control.
  3. Connect the TX and RX units using an Ethernet cable or through an Ethernet switch.
  4. Connect the display to the HDMI OUT port on the RX unit.
  5. Connect the keyboard and mouse to the USB ports on the RX unit.
  6. Connect the DC 5 V power adapters to both units.
  7. Wait for the Power and HDMI status indicators to illuminate.

Technical Note

This product is presented as an HDMI KVM IP Extender and supports point-to-point, point-to-multipoint, and cascade connection modes.

The packaging does not clearly confirm whether it supports transmission across routed subnets, VLAN-routed networks, or the public internet. These deployment scenarios should be tested before the product is used in a production project.
